Longtime Kentucky Resident Julie Ann Copeland Passes Away at 67
Copeland was known for her lifelong community service and passion for UK basketball.
Apr. 3, 2026 at 7:31pm
Got story updates? Submit your updates here. ›
The vibrant life and generous spirit of longtime Kentucky resident Julie Ann Copeland are remembered through an intimate, abstracted portrait of her cherished home.Benton TodayJulie Ann Copeland, a 67-year-old resident of Calvert City, Kentucky, passed away at her home on March 31, 2026. Copeland was born in Murray, Kentucky and spent her life working in various roles, including as a waitress, program manager for the Veterans Administration, and volunteer for numerous local organizations. She was an avid supporter of the University of Kentucky basketball team and passed on her love of the 'Cats to her grandchildren.

The details
Copeland worked a variety of jobs over the years, including as a waitress at local restaurants from age 13 into her 40s. She later worked as a program manager for the Veterans Administration and spent several years at the Salvation Army before retiring. Throughout her life, Copeland volunteered with numerous organizations, serving as the secretary of the Democratic Party and on the committee for the Division of Reentry Services, among other roles. She was known for her generous spirit and advocacy for the underdogs in her community.
- Copeland passed away at her home in Calvert City, Kentucky on March 31, 2026.
- Visitation will be held from 11:00 AM to 1:00 PM on Tuesday, April 7, 2026.
- Funeral services will be held at 1:00 PM on Tuesday, April 7, 2026.
